Bible Quote by Oswald Chambers
“Faith by its very nature must be tried, and the real trial of faith is not that we find it difficult to trust God, but that God's character has to be cleared in our own minds. Faith in its actual working out has to go through spells of unsyllabled isolation... 'Though He slay me, yet will I trust Him.' - this is the most sublime utterance of faith in the whole of the Bible.”
